How to Open Excel File on Mac

Open Excel spreadsheets on Mac effortlessly using the Numbers application, the native spreadsheet app for macOS. Numbers supports a wide array of files, including Microsoft Excel files, ensuring seamless access to your data.

Opening Excel Spreadsheets

Launch Numbers to open Excel files saved on your Mac, iCloud Drive, connected servers, or through third-party storage providers. Numbers' compatibility with Excel allows you to view and edit your spreadsheets directly on your Mac.

Working with Text Files

Numbers is not limited to Excel files; it can also handle delimited and fixed-width text files. Import these text formats into Numbers for a streamlined workflow on your Mac.

Managing Multiple Spreadsheets

Enhance productivity by opening multiple spreadsheets in tabs within Numbers. Easily merge spreadsheets from various sources into one window with tabs for better organization and comparison.

Closing Spreadsheets

After editing or viewing your Excel files, Numbers allows you to close individual spreadsheets while keeping the application open, or you can choose to close Numbers entirely.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I open an Excel file on my Mac?

You can open an Excel file on Mac by either double-clicking the file, or dragging it to the Numbers icon in the Dock or Applications folder. Alternatively, you can launch Numbers, navigate to your Excel file in the window that opens, and click Open.

What types of Excel files can be opened on Mac?

Mac's Numbers app can open Excel files with .xls and .xlsx extensions, as well as .csv and tab-delimited files.

What should I do if Excel for Mac shows a warning that it cannot open the .xlsx file?

If Excel for Mac shows a warning that it cannot open the .xlsx file because the format or extension is not valid, you can try opening the file using Apple's Numbers app as an alternative solution.
